Feature Request: SSL (Step Speed Loss) in RunningDynamicsData for Connect IQ (Or make Toybox.BLESecure.RunningDynamicsData)

I'm a runner who uses HRM 600 + Fenix 8 pro - The watch collects SSL (Step Speed Loss) metric during running, but it is not available in Toybox.AntPlus.RunningDynamicsData (nor via SensorHistory) in the SDK.

Could you please consider exposing SSL and/or SSL% as part of the Running Dynamics API so that data-fields and apps can access it? This would enable richer running-dynamics features and better integration with third-party hardware (e.g., glasses from ActiveLook). I want to be able to do a PR to expose these to Engo eyewear for users who have spent a lot of money adopting Garmin Running Dynamics on Modern watch/HRM.

I don't see it exposed here:

https://developer.garmin.com/connect-iq/api-docs/Toybox/AntPlus/RunningDynamicsData.html

There is a pretty bad UX around this, if i want to use the HRM 600 with datafields (such as my Engo eyewear) I have to run it in ANT+ mode, but in doing so, I lose the SSL feature of the 600 making it an HRM 200.

Garmin needs to add SSL to AntPlus or make a toybox that exposes running dynamics over BLE since it seems Secure Bluetooth is the "Way of the future" as mandated by EU and other regulatory bodies.
